iSEM Oberheim SEM iPad

iSEM is a recreation of the classic 1974 Oberheim SEM (Synthesizer Expander Module), one of the world’s first self-contained synthesizer modules and the first to bear the “Oberheim Electronics” name.

The Oberheim SEM was made famous by artists and bands such as Lyle Mays, Jan Hammer, Joseph Zawinul, Supertramp, 808 State, Vince Clarke and Depeche Mode.

Based on the TAE® technology found in our Oberheim SEM V software, iSEM brings back the sound and special characteristics of this iconic synth in an sonically accurate and expanded touch-based emulation.

FEATURES
All the original parameters of the Oberheim SEM: two oscillators, each offering sawtooth wave and variable-width pulse wave with PWM, sine wave LFO, 12dB/oct multi-mode Filter with low-pass, high-pass, band-pass and notch, two ADS envelope generators.

Added functionalities: New LFO, Noise, Sub oscillator, Arpeggiator, Portamento.
Polyphonic playability
8 Voice Programmer module allows each voice to have different settings
HOLD and CHORD modes.
Virtual Analog Chorus.
Virtual Analog Delay.
Full user MIDI mapping of panel controls.
Supports WIST sync to other iOS devices.
Supports AudioBus and Apple’s Inter-App Audio connectivity (requires iOS7).

Harp App For iPad

Compatibility:Requires iOS 6.0 or later.compatible with iPhone4 or later,iPad,and iPod touch(5th Generation).optimized for iPhone 5

Handy Harp explains the complex mechanisms behind a concert harp through sounds and pictures, in an easy-to-use application where the design of harp pedals has been carefully recreated. Using the touch capabilities offered by the iPhone and iPad screen, you can manipulate these pedals easily, hear the changes of interval, and also watch the rotating discs prompting these changes.

Furthermore, the application allows you to quickly display 45 chord types, 28 modes, and the associated pedal settings. It supports MIDI Wi-Fi, allowing you to transfer play data from your iPhone or iPad to a Digital Audio Workstation as well as pedal diagrams to softwares such as Sibelius and Finale.

Handy Harp can be used in many different contexts: for those who want to understand the mechanisms of the harp, for harpists who want to write a pedal diagram on their sheet music, for composers and arrangers who want to try out different kinds of glissandi, and many other situations.

Handy Harp is available not only in Japanese, but also in English and in French. Its goal is to provide an easy-to-use tool that will become the new best friend of harpists, composers of film music and orchestrators. This is the beginning of a new era for harp!

[28 modes, 45 pre-recorded chords]
45 chords are pre-recorded (in twelve tones), for a total of 540 possibilities. 28 modes are also available (in twelve tones) for a total of 336 pedals tuning possibilities. It is possible to save up to 60 additional pedal settings.

[Rule Types]
You can select two different types of rules when displaying the scales and octaves: one that is commonly used by harpists, and the other based on the piano keyboard.

[Irregular Tuning]
Usually, each note on a harp is tuned in flat, but in order to support certain types of music, Handy Harp also features irregular tuning, thus allowing you to perform pieces of contemporary music.

[Keyboard]
In order to check the status of the harp pedals, and in addition to a concrete display, a piano keyboard shows the select notes (using letters). This allows you to easily check the tuning of the pedals.

[MIDI Wi-Fi]
By connecting your device to a computer through MIDI Wi-Fi, you can transfer your play data in MIDI format to a DAW and record them. This function will prove invaluable to composers and arrangers who lost a considerable amount of time recording each harp section.

[Transfer your pedal diagram to a music notation software]
You can transfer pedal diagrams to music notation softwares such as Sibelius and Finale.

iTuttle iPad Synthesizer

iTuttle is an Awesome Fat & Warm Subtractive Monophonic Synthesizer.

Fat by Design with its 9 oscillators section, all waveforms (but Sinus with oscillators) use generalized PWM (called “Ratio”), so you can tune/modulate the waveform of each oscillator / LFO.

Its huge modulations capabilities lets you create a very large sound styles.

The arpeggiator includes an 8 steps sequencer and lets you mute, change the gate duration, the groove and the velocity of each step. In addition, you can use the global Shuffle to humanize your arpeggios.

Specifications :
► 9 Oscillators section organized on 3 Oscillator Modes (8 waveforms)
► White Noise
► Full Stereo path (from Oscillators Section to FX)
► 24dB/oct Filter (Low Pass, Band Pass & Hi Pass)
► 3 Envelopes
► 2 LFOs (11 waveforms with Generalized PWM, even with Sinus/Cosinus)
► 2 X/Y Pads
► 8 Modulation Slots (20 Sources and 67 Destinations !!!)
► Arpeggiator with Shuffle/Groove and Step Controls
► Stereo Delay with delay time modulation capability
► Full MIDI implementation
► Background Audio
► Korg WIST support
► User Bank sharing with Mail/Safari
